Vilkos Tarf Konpati in context

With 574 people at the 2011 Census, Vilkos Tarf Konpati was the 1339th most populous of its district's 1721 villages, below the district average of 1,479.

The sex ratio was 1014 women per 1,000 men (56 above the district's rural figure of 958) — one of the minority of villages where women outnumbered men.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1070, 147 above the rural national 923.

25.4% of the population were recorded as workers, 20.5 points below the district's rural rate.
